Job Requirements:

  • Support the materials / Shipping & Receiving departments by being responsible for storage of Master Rolls.

  • Supply Finishing department with rolls and supplies, transport packaged rolls to the shipping department and enter all roll information into the computerized inventory system.

    Responsibilities:

  • Read and comprehend written instructions.

  • Transport Master Rolls to roll storage area.

  • Maintain a current Fork Truck Operator's License, training supplied by Alkegen.

  • Follow all Plant, Safety, and department rules and regulations.

  • Maintain a Safety-first attitude in the performance of all tasks.

  • Properly scan the movement of all products within the mill.

  • Must be able to work alternate shifts or extended hours when necessary, including some weekends / holidays.

  • Able to work in a Team environment and contribute positive input / feedback to management.

    Qualifications/ Experience:

  • High School Diploma or equivalent

  • Basic Computer skills

  • Able to operate a forklift in tight areas without incident.

  • Knowledge of the Oracle inventory system is a plus.

  • Able to learn and improve upon new and existing Logistic practices.
